制作html网时如何将图片铺满全屏?最好是解释清楚点儿咯
background:url(xx.jpg) ;这一句就是让图片铺满全屏的呀,如果你是加了
no-repeat的话,就不会铺满全屏了,再一个,你也可以写上一句:
background-size:100% 100%,就是让图片百分百显示,不过这样会对图片有拉伸,而且不兼容ie低版本的浏览器。
ps图片一拉伸就不清楚了
拉伸图片会导致图片失真,因为拉伸会改变图片的像素分辨率,从而影响图片的清晰度和细节。
当图片被拉伸时,像素会被拉伸并填充到新的像素位置,这会导致图片变得模糊和失真。
这种情况可以通过使用高分辨率的图片来避免。
高分辨率的图片包含更多的像素,因此可以更好地适应不同的尺寸和比例。
此外,使用矢量图形也可以避免拉伸失真的问题,因为矢量图形是基于数学公式而不是像素的。
如果需要拉伸图片,可以尝试以下方法来减少失真:
1.使用图像编辑软件,如Photoshop,将图片放大到所需的尺寸,然后使用锐化工具来增强细节和清晰度。
2.使用CSS的background-size属性来调整背景图片的大小,而不是直接拉伸图片。
3.使用图片压缩工具来减少图片文件大小,以便在拉伸时减少失真。
总之,拉伸图片会导致失真,因此应该尽可能避免。
如果必须拉伸图片,可以使用高分辨率的图片或矢量图形,并使用图像编辑软件和CSS属性来减少失真。
1、用ps打开要修改的图片。
2、点击图像标签中的图像大小。
3、修改图片的长宽参数。
4、图片放大后再点击滤镜中的锐化滤镜。
5、适当调整锐化的参数即可。这样ps图片拉伸就清楚了。
是的,拉伸图片会导致失真不清晰
图片在被拉伸时,实际上是在增加或减少像素,从而使图像的分辨率发生变化,从而导致图片的清晰度大幅度降低,失去了原本的细节和质量
如果需要放大图片而不产生失真,可以使用一些额外的工具和技术,如放大像素和保持原有图片的高清晰度
如果我们想要将一张图片进行拉伸放大,比如说一张线条的图片,拉伸放大之后就不清晰了,这是因为原图的像素过低造成的,如果没有高质量的图片,我们只能用Photoshop的填充工具来调整了。
首先我们用选取工具将线条选定,然后填充相同的颜色即可
css如何将大照片放入小盒子
使用CSS可以将大照片放入小盒子的方法有以下几种:
1. 使用`background-size`属性进行背景图片大小调整:
```css
.box {
width: 200px;
height: 200px;
background-image: url("大照片的URL");
background-size: cover;
background-position: center;
}
```
这里通过`background-size: cover`将背景图片等比例缩放,以填满整个小盒子,并通过`background-position: center`将图片居中显示在盒子内。
2. 使用`object-fit`属性进行图片大小调整:
```css
.box {
width: 200px;
height: 200px;
overflow: hidden;
}
.box img {
width: 100%;
height: 100%;
object-fit: cover;
}
```
这里通过将图片设为盒子的宽度和高度,并使用`object-fit: cover`将图片等比例缩放以填满整个盒子。同时,通过设置`overflow: hidden`隐藏溢出的部分,以确保图片不会超出盒子。
无论使用何种方法,都需要为小盒子设置固定的宽度和高度,并根据需要调整图片的样式以适应盒子大小。
还没有评论,来说两句吧...